MacArgon is a computer program that simulates argon retention in minerals and rocks. It allows users to input arbitrary pressure-temperature paths and calculates the diffusion of argon from mineral grains. MacArgon can replicate data obtained from temperature-controlled furnace-step-heating experiments and bulk fusion.
